Title: Amino Acid Precursor for Human Skin Color Pigment: Tyrosine Explained (MCQ Solved)**

Tyrosine is the amino acid precursor for melanin, the pigment responsible for human skin color.

Correct Answer: 3. Tyrosine

Melanin synthesis begins in melanocytes where the enzyme tyrosinase converts tyrosine to DOPA and then dopaquinone, leading to eumelanin (brown-black) or pheomelanin (yellow-red). This pathway determines skin tone, hair color, and UV protection, with variations explaining diverse human pigmentation.

Melanin Biosynthesis Pathway

Tyrosine → L-DOPA (tyrosinase) → dopaquinone → melanin polymers. Tyrosinase is rate-limiting; defects cause albinism (OCA1). Phenylalanine converts to tyrosine via phenylalanine hydroxylase, linking diet to pigmentation.

Explanation of All Options

Option Role Why Correct/Incorrect
1. Tryptophan Serotonin, niacin precursor. Incorrect: Neurotransmitter synthesis; no role in melanogenesis.
2. Cholesterol Steroid hormone, membrane precursor. Incorrect: Lipid; unrelated to pigment pathway.
3. Tyrosine Melanin direct precursor via tyrosinase. Correct: First step in skin pigment formation.
4. Indoleamine Tryptophan metabolite (e.g., serotonin). Incorrect: Neuroactive; not pigment-related.
